Markdown是一种轻量级标记语言,它允许人们使用易读易写的纯文本格式编写文档,然后转换成格式丰富的HTML页面。Markdown语法简单,易于学习,是现代文档写作、博客编辑、技术文档编写等场景中非常受欢迎的工具。本篇文章将带领大家从零开始,轻松学会Markdown,并通过实例解析,帮助快速掌握排版技巧。
基础语法
1. 标题
在Markdown中,使用不同的符号和空格来表示不同的标题级别。
- 一级标题:
# 标题内容 - 二级标题:
## 标题内容 - 三级标题:
### 标题内容 - 依此类推,最多支持六级标题。
2. 段落
直接在两个换行符之间输入文本,Markdown会自动将它们转换为段落。
3. 强调
- 斜体:
*斜体文本* - 粗体:
**粗体文本** - 斜粗体:
***斜粗体文本***
4. 列表
- 无序列表:
- 列表项1 - 有序列表:
1. 列表项1
5. 链接
- 行内链接:
[链接文本](链接地址) - 参考链接:
[链接文本][引用编号] - 引用编号:
[引用编号]: 链接地址
6. 图片
- 行内图片:
 - 参考图片:
![图片描述][引用编号] - 引用编号:
[引用编号]: 图片地址
7. 引用
- 行内引用:
> 引用内容 - 多行引用:
> 引用内容 > 引用内容 >
8. 分隔线
- 空一行,输入三个或更多短横线、星号或下划线,即可创建分隔线。
实例解析
下面是一个简单的Markdown文档实例,展示如何使用上述语法:
# Markdown入门教程
## 基础语法
### 标题
这是一个一级标题。
### 段落
这是一个段落。
### 强调
这是一个斜体文本。
这是一个粗体文本。
### 列表
- 无序列表项1
- 无序列表项2
1. 有序列表项1
2. 有序列表项2
### 链接
这是一个行内链接[链接文本](http://www.example.com)。
这是一个参考链接[链接文本][1]。
[1]: http://www.example.com "示例网站"
### 图片

### 引用
> 这是一个引用。
### 分隔线
---
## 高级语法
### 代码块
```python
def hello_world():
print("Hello, world!")
表格
| 表头1 | 表头2 | 表头3 |
|---|---|---|
| 内容1 | 内容2 | 内容3 |
”`
排版技巧
掌握Markdown语法后,如何进行排版就变得尤为重要。以下是一些排版技巧:
- 合理使用空格和换行:空格和换行可以使文档结构更加清晰。
- 注意字体和字号:Markdown本身不控制字体和字号,但可以通过CSS进行自定义。
- 使用图片和图表:图片和图表可以使文档更加生动有趣。
- 添加脚注:对于一些需要解释的术语或概念,可以添加脚注。
通过以上学习,相信你已经对Markdown有了初步的了解。在实际应用中,多加练习,不断积累经验,你会越来越熟练地使用Markdown进行文档编写。祝你在Markdown的世界里畅游无阻!
